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97 668784291 182667766
33907 00669205
33907 00669205
12739183364 50 876
All about undefined
Interested in learning more?
33907 00669205
12739183364 50 876
See more
979349 649
5726 0697 94 1016
See more
85784 9522
61221497 44 77596326 06 05424690924
See more